How can I use arbitrage tools to maximize my profits in the cryptocurrency market?
What are some effective ways to utilize arbitrage tools in order to maximize profits in the cryptocurrency market?
3 answers
- Alhaji Bunu MohammedMar 29, 2021 · 5 years agoOne effective way to maximize profits in the cryptocurrency market using arbitrage tools is to take advantage of price differences between different exchanges. By monitoring the prices of cryptocurrencies on multiple exchanges, you can identify opportunities where the price of a cryptocurrency is lower on one exchange and higher on another. You can then buy the cryptocurrency at the lower price and sell it at the higher price, making a profit in the process. It's important to note that arbitrage opportunities may be short-lived, so it's crucial to act quickly and have a reliable arbitrage tool that can help you execute trades efficiently.
